At the 2025 Cannes Film Festival, the L’Œil d’or jury celebrated documentaries that confront silence, trauma, and resistance. Imago, a poetic meditation on war and memory, took the top prize, while Eugene Jarecki’s film on Julian Assange earned a special award for its political urgency.
